Transaction 76365ad0d5055233100cb3e0109027366faa92d3cfb82f194b8daf7fcffa217a
1 Input
1 Output
-
76365ad0d5055233100cb3e0109027366faa92d3cfb82f194b8daf7fcffa217a:0
- value
- 18890373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a747b0eac11bf8acc9908b2bc1ad0f6f24d1c12d OP_EQUAL
- address
- 3GwWemDToTmjbTAjv2ciZEQnedLkAiyNff